CarBuzz Detroit News reports that GM has such heavy demand for GMC Sierra trucks its Oshawa plant in Ontario will come back online next year and that it will invest $75 million in its transmission plant in Toledo, Ohio. It seems that while GM is gearing up to ensure it has 30 EVs on the market by 2025 and its entire range is emissions-free by 2035, it still has to satisfy the demand for piston-powered trucks. Order books for the Mercedes EQA are now open in Germany. Last month, Mercedes expanded its EQ electric family with the new entry-level EQA crossover. In EQA 250 guise, the electric crossovers single-motor electric powertrain produces 188 horsepower and 276 lb-ft of torque, which is sent to the front wheels. Year-on-year sales were down by as whopping 68 percent. The global pandemic had a huge impact on new car sales in 2020, but it wasnt bad news for every automaker. Many car manufacturers still managed to end the year on a high with record sales months. Subarus US sales, for example, were up by 16 percent in September 2020 compared to September 2019 thanks to popular models like the Forester.
